In
Andy
Tennant's
(SWEET
HOME
ALABAMA,
ANNA
AND
THE
KING)
delightful
romantic
comedy
HITCH,
Will
Smith
stars
as
Alex
Hitchens,
an
urban
"date
doctor"
who
helps
the
common
man
woo
the
woman
of
his
dreams.
Hitch
will
use
any
means
necessary--dance
lessons,
back
waxing--to
instill
romantic
confidence
in
his
clientele.
Why?
He
was
once
a
lonely
wallflower
himself,
who
learned
about
love
and
heartbreak
the
hard
way.
His
latest
project,
Albert
Brennaman
(Kevin
James),
may
be
his
most
difficult.
Brennaman,
a
junior
accountant
prone
to
clumsiness,
has
fallen
head-over-heels
for
one
of
his
clients,
Allegra
Cole
(Amber
Valleta),
a
well-known
celebrity.
To
complicate
things
further,
Hitch's
dating
dogma
is
shaken
when
he
meets
and
falls
for
a
beautiful
gossip
columnist,
Sara
Melas
(Eva
Mendes),
whose
sharp
wit
easily
pierces
his
cool
façade.
Conflict
arises
when
Melas
uncovers
Hitch's
true
profession
and
blames
him
for
her
best
friend
being
dumped.
HITCH
is
set
in
affluent
hot
spots
around
New
York
City,
making
for
some
splendid
visuals.
Tennant
gets
charming
performances
from
all
of
his
leads,
especially
James,
who
makes
an
amazing
transition
from
television's
KING
OF
QUEENS
and
nearly
steals
the
spotlight
from
Smith
with
his
talent
for
physical
comedy.
Nevertheless,
James
and
Smith
have
excellent
onscreen
chemistry.
Kevin
Bisch's
first
script
is
full
of
clever,
contemporary
dialogue,
alternately
pointing
out
the
silliness
and
the
poignancy
of
love
and
dating.
